Events
★ April 14 — Pope Celestine III succeeds Pope Clement III as the 175th pope.
★ April 17 — Tusculum's destruction by Commune of Rome army.
★ May 12 — Richard I of England marries Berengaria of Navarre.
★ July 12 — Saladin's garrison surrenders, ending the two-year siege of Acre. Conrad of Montferrat, who has negotiated the surrender, raises the banners of the Kingdom of Jerusalem and of the Third Crusade leaders Richard I of England, Philip II of France, and Leopold V of Austria on the city's walls and towers.
★ September 7 — Third Crusade: Battle of Arsuf — Richard I of England defeats Saladin at Arsuf.
★ November 27 — Election of Reginald Fitz Jocelin as Archbishop of Canterbury
Unknown dates
★ The monks of Glastonbury Abbey announce that they have found the burial sites of King Arthur and his Queen Guinevere.
★ Duke Berthold V of Zähringen founds the city of Berne in today's Switzerland.
★ Khmer king Jayavarman VII sacks the capital of Champa.
